• Martin Storsjö's avatar
    aarch64: vp8: Port bilin functions from arm version · e39a9212
    Martin Storsjö authored
                          Cortex A53     A72     A73
    vp8_put_bilin4_h_c:        303.8   102.2   161.8
    vp8_put_bilin4_h_neon:     100.0    40.9    41.2
    vp8_put_bilin4_hv_c:       322.8   201.0   305.9
    vp8_put_bilin4_hv_neon:    156.8    72.6    77.0
    vp8_put_bilin4_v_c:        304.7   101.7   166.5
    vp8_put_bilin4_v_neon:      82.7    41.2    33.0
    vp8_put_bilin8_h_c:       1192.7   352.5   623.8
    vp8_put_bilin8_h_neon:     213.5    70.2    87.8
    vp8_put_bilin8_hv_c:      1098.6   769.2  1041.9
    vp8_put_bilin8_hv_neon:    324.0   123.5   146.0
    vp8_put_bilin8_v_c:       1193.9   350.4   617.7
    vp8_put_bilin8_v_neon:     183.9    60.7    64.7
    vp8_put_bilin16_h_c:      2353.1   671.2  1223.3
    vp8_put_bilin16_h_neon:    261.9   140.7   145.0
    vp8_put_bilin16_hv_c:     2453.2  1470.9  2355.2
    vp8_put_bilin16_hv_neon:   383.9   196.0   217.0
    vp8_put_bilin16_v_c:      2349.3   669.8  1251.2
    vp8_put_bilin16_v_neon:    202.9   110.7    96.2
    Signed-off-by: 's avatarMartin Storsjö <martin@martin.st>
    e39a9212
vp8dsp_init_aarch64.c 5.94 KB